OneWireless Gauge Reader

The OneWireless Gauge Reader wirelessly monitors manual readings from existing dial gauges, allowing operators to analyze critical equipment-health and process information and make decisions that improve plant operations. The reader nonintrusively attaches to existing gauges without disrupting ongoing processes, and it is not necessary to remove old gauges, break pressure seals or run wires. The data it collects are displayed on both field devices and operator consoles in the control room.

Optimass 1300 straight-tube Coriolis mass meter

The Optimass 1300 straight-tube Coriolis mass meter records mass flow, density, temperature and concentration of liquids and gases. It combines the straight-tube technology of the Optimass 7000 with the dual-tube configuration of the Optimass 1000, and features an optimized flow splitter to minimize pressure loss. It meets FM Class 1, Div. 1 requirements for use in hazardous conditions. It is made of stainless steel, and is not affected by installation constraints or external influences.

UCL-520 Series ultrasonic level sensor

The UCL-520 Series ultrasonic level sensor is a two-wire transmitter that is built with a rugged polyvinylidene fluoride (PVDF) transducer so it can handle ultra-pure, corrosive and waste liquids. Its 3-in. minimum beam width permits easy installation in applications with limited space, and its minimum 8-in. deadband allows the maximum amount of media to fill the tank. The sensor is push-button-calibrated with a 6-segment liquid crystal display (LCD).

Microspec MCP-100 analyzer

The Microspec MCP-100 online real-time water-in-solvents analyzer offers considerable savings over current technologies. It can replace equipment in labs where personnel perform routine liquid-sample applications that require titration to determine the quantity of water in the sample — with the MCP-100, this measurement is performed continuously.

Micro Motion 7835 Series density meters

Micro Motion 7835 Series density meters reduce project and installation costs in hazardous areas because they require neither barriers nor galvanic isolators. They are certified as explosionproof and flameproof, making them suitable for custody-transfer and fiscal applications in the oil and gas industries; they can also be used for routine control applications in chemical and other processing industries. The units provide high-accuracy measurements and require little maintenance.

Sitrans LVL100 and LVL200 vibratory switches

Sitrans LVL100 and LVL200 vibratory switches indicate when the level of a liquid is sufficiently high or when a vessel needs to be refilled. They are equipped with an extremely reliable piezo actuator, and are suitable for high temperatures. If the electronics system detects damage or corrosion, the fail-safe switches trigger an alarm. The switches are compact and user-friendly, and can measure reliably even under changing conditions, such as when there are variations in the dielectric permit-tivity of a medium or upon the formation of vapor or bubbles.

KSonic Micro

The KSonic Micro is a compact, low-cost, ultrasonic level transmitter/ switch that is designed for liquid and bulk solids level applications. Ultrasonic measurements are based on the time of flight (TOF) of an acoustic wave that is emitted from a transducer and directed toward the product being measured. This wave is reflected back toward the transducer and then converted to an electric signal.

Traceable infrared thermometer

The Traceable infrared thermometer can take readings on any surface, including solids, semi-solids, and liquids. Its non-invasive, non-contact measurements make it suitable for food preparation, life science, pharmaceutical, petroleum, clean room, electronics, and field applications. Each unit has an individually serial-numbered Traceable certificate indicating ISO 17025 accreditation and compliance with National Institute of Standards and Technology (NIST) traceability standards.

Type A-10 industrial pressure transmitter

The Type A-10 industrial pressure transmitter is designed to withstand harsh operating conditions, such as shock and heavy vibration. Its construction is resistant to mechanical damage and eliminates stress on the pins of the piezo-sensor. With few sources of potential error, the failure rate is reduced to a minimum. The transmitter is easy to set up and operate, and is suitable for use in hydraulics/pneumatics, pumps and compressors.
